Senior .NET Software Engineer
18000-22600 PLN miesięcznie (Umowa o pracę)
dotLinkers
Czym będziesz się zajmować?
Responsibilities:- Architect and design performant, scalable, and secure software to a high degree of quality – not simply focusing on meeting requirements
- Work hand in hand with the Applied science team and product team to design new search solutions, think about migrations, and stress test current ideas
- Build systems in the search domain – that are integrated with LLMs, are secure and performant while serving the user needs.
- Be pragmatic – in using object-oriented principles, applying SOLID principles and design patterns in a variety of languages such as SQL, Javascript, and C# (with nice to have Rust) to drive value for our users
- Contribute and provide technical guidance to a software development team to ship high-quality, performant, secure software that operates on data at a massive scale
- Conduct comprehensive unit and integration testing static analysis and rigorous test strategy development
- Improve the software development process by recommending and instituting changes in procedures
- Provide technical guidance to team members through education and coaching of best practice object-oriented principles
- Participates in regular on-call rotations
- Embrace and contribute to a learning/growth culture and promote a healthy work environment
Kogo poszukujemy?
Qualifications:- At least 5 years of experience in software development using C# and relational databases and no-SQL databases (ideally Elastic-Search, but others are ok
- Nice to have is experience with Vector Search – in any form (Pinecone, pgVector, Elastic, or others) and Rust – or willingness to learn it
- Experience in working with large-scale data – 10s of TB of data at least – you will be working with very large-scale data here and you need to be comfortable with it
- Understanding of cloud-native architecture patterns, distributed system architecture patterns, and practical approaches to maintaining and troubleshooting high-load production systems in the cloud
- Experience being part of an Agile software team, including mentoring and project leadership
- Experience developing scalable solutions in Azure or other cloud platforms and building observable systems with SLA and SLOs defined
- Experience in CI/CD
- Understanding DevOps principles and working with
- Comprehensive health plan
- Flexible work arrangements
- Two, week-long company breaks per year
- Unlimited time off
- Long-term incentive program
- Training investment program
Czego wymagamy?
Znajomości:
Mile widziane:
Języki:
- Polski
- Angielski
Jakie warunki i benefity otrzymasz?
- 18000-22580 PLN miesięcznie (Umowa o pracę)
- Umowa o pracę - Elastyczne godziny pracy (100%)
- Praca zdalna: Możliwa częściowo
- Budżet szkoleniowy, Szkolenia wewnętrzne
- Pakiet medyczny, Pakiet sportowy
Gdzie będziesz pracował?
Centrum, Kraków lub hybrydowo
Kim jesteśmy?
We are an established IT Recruitment Agency. We recruit the best IT specialists for the best IT companies – as simple as that! If you would like to be called using words as « recent », « disruptive », « breakthrough », « the only one », « making the change », « unique », etc. we definitely are the IT Recruitment Agency that should work for you.